My Plan A didn't work.What is Plan A?

Oh wait..before i start, let's go through my first encounter with cancer cells.

Jan 2012 - Lump detected in Right breast. (BP Lab)
Dec 2012 - Lump confirmed Cancerous. Clinically stage 3. size 12cm (Sunway Med Centre)
Feb 2013 ~ May 2013 - Chemotherapy. Responded well. Tumour reduced to 6cm. (UH @ PPUM)
June 2013 - Mastectomy (UH @ PPUM)
July 2013 - Radiotheraphy (UH @ PPUM).

Parking space in PPUM is precious especially during the school holiday.

Options?
1. Get someone to drive you there and wait for you. The procedure minus the waiting time is only 10mins.
    Get yourself to the Oncology-Radio section by 11.30am and the most is having 3 people ahead of you.
    If you go at 8am, you will have at least 20pax ahead of you
2. Park at Crystal crown hotel and take a cab there.
3. Park by the roadside,
4. Naik taxi all the way. habis citer.

For those who wonder how much chemotheraphy costs, well here it is.
Hospital: PPUM/UMMC
Non-gov staff so has to pay on my own.

Pre-chemo (a day before chemo) - 3 weeks from the last chemo:
Take blood for test (immunity). Chemo will need to be postponed if my Blood count was not sufficient. (Luckily, mine was ok. all 6)
Review appointment with Oncologists to check on my condition.
Measure the tumour.
Get MC and prescription.
Go get anti-vomitting medicine.
Cost:
Oncologist & Blood test: RM67.00
Medicine: RM5 (From kaunter ubat biasa) and RM27 for 1pc of Kytril (from PharmUMMC-Farmasi).
Total: RM99.

Chemo day (if blood test ok. No news means good news):
Chemo which lasted about 2 hours.
Cost: about RM30

Total per chemo: RM129.00 excluding other expenses and extra medicine from pharmacy (if any).

But company got insurance kan? so claim la.
It's covered under Daycare and fee deducted from Hospitalisation fund (not the Clinic care fund).
